Huawei Ascend W1 vs Samsung Galaxy A40
Huawei Ascend W1 vs Samsung Galaxy A40: Comparing the Huawei Ascend W1 and Samsung Galaxy A40, we delve into the features and specifications of these two smartphones. Discover the differences and similarities between these popular devices, helping you make an informed decision when choosing your next smartphone.
Feature | Huawei Ascend W1 | Samsung Galaxy A40 |
---|---|---|
Operating System | Windows Phone 8 | Android 9.0 (Pie) |
Display Size | 4.0 inches | 5.9 inches |
Display Type | TFT LCD | Super AMOLED |
Resolution | 480 x 800 pixels | 1080 x 2340 pixels |
Processor | Dual-core 1.2 GHz Krait | Octa-core (2×1.8 GHz Cortex-A73 & 6×1.6 GHz Cortex-A53) |
RAM | 512 MB | 4 GB |
Internal Storage | 4 GB | 64 GB |
Expandable Storage | Yes, up to 32 GB (microSD) | Yes, up to 1 TB (microSD) |
Main Camera | 5 MP | 16 MP (f/1.7) |
Front Camera | 0.3 MP | 25 MP (f/2.0) |
Video Recording | 720p@30fps | 1080p@30fps |
Battery Capacity | 1950 mAh | 3100 mAh |
Fast Charging | No | Yes, 15W |
Wireless Charging | No | No |
Biometric Authentication | No | Fingerprint (rear-mounted) |
Connectivity | 3G,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Bluetooth 2.1, GPS | 4G LT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, Bluetooth 5.0, GPS |
Dimensions | 124.5 x 63.7 x 10.5 mm | 144.4 x 69.2 x 7.9 mm |
Weight | 130 g | 140 g |
